Actor Sean Penn “suspicious” of Wyclef Jean’s run to become President of Haiti

WASHINGTON, D.C. (BNO NEWS) — Actor Sean Penn in an interview on CNN Thursday night said to be “suspicious” about singer Wyclef Jean’s run to become President of Haiti.
“Right now I worry that this is a campaign that is more about a vision of lying around the world talking to people as [Wyclef Jean] said,” Penn, who has been very active in the recovery efforts that have been taking place in Haiti since the devastating earthquake last January, stated.
Co-founding the J/P Haitian Relief Organization, Penn has been helping with a 55,000-person tent. In the interview, he said to be in constant contact with a 24-year-old woman who is facing a life and death situation because she did not have adequate treatment of a tooth infection, showing his involvement in the recovery efforts.
“What the Haitian people need now is a leader who genuinely is willing to sacrifice,” the actor continued. “I haven’t seen or heard anything of him in these last six months that I’ve been in Haiti.”
“I think he is an important voice. I hope he doesn’t sacrifice that voice by taking the eye off of the very devastating realities on the ground, and the very difficult strategic future that it has got to bringing itself back together,” Penn continued, noting that he was not accusing Wyclef o being an opportunist as he personally does not know him.
“This is somebody who’s going to receive an enormous amount of support from the United States, and I have to say I’m very suspicious of it, simply because he, as an ambassador at large, has been virtually silent. For those of us in Haiti, he has been a non-presence,” Penn added.
Wyclef Jean has been facing allegations of mishandling $400,000 donated for Haiti through the singer’s Yele Haiti foundation, and taking the money for himself. “That has to be looked into,” Penn said. “I’ve been there. I know what $400,000 could do for these people’s lives,” he added.
“I want to see someone who is really willing to sacrifice and not just someone that I personally saw with a vulgar entourage of vehicles that demonstrated a wealth in Haiti that in context I felt was a very obscene demonstration.”
